Ibn Sina Uttara, generally known as Avicenna, was a renowned Persian polymath who built important contributions to numerous fields for example drugs, philosophy, and astronomy. He was born in 980 inside the village of Afshana, in close proximity to Bukhara in present-day Uzbekistan. His father, Abdullah, was a respected scholar and government official, which furnished Ibn Sina with access to a wealth of information and means from a young age. He shown exceptional intelligence as well as a thirst for Discovering, which led him to study an array of subjects which include arithmetic, logic, and Islamic theology.
At the age of 16, Ibn Sina began learning medication and immediately gained a track record for his knowledge in the sector. He was specially interested in the functions of Galen and Aristotle, which laid the foundation for his later contributions to health-related science. Together with his scientific tests in medication, Ibn Sina also delved into philosophy and metaphysics, drawing inspiration with the will work of Plato and Plotinus. His insatiable curiosity and devotion to Mastering established the stage for his potential accomplishments in each the scientific and philosophical realms.
Contributions to Medicine and Philosophy
Ibn Sina's most vital contribution to drugs was his magnum opus, "The Canon of Medication," which became the standard medical textbook in Europe and the Islamic environment for more than six centuries. This in depth get the job done synthesized the health care understanding of the time, drawing from Greek, Roman, Persian, and Indian resources. It lined a wide range of subject areas like anatomy, physiology, pathology, and pharmacology, and supplied detailed descriptions of assorted ailments as well as their solutions. Ibn Sina's emphasis on empirical observation and systematic experimentation set a different normal for medical exercise and laid the groundwork for modern evidence-based medication.
In addition to his groundbreaking operate in medicine, Ibn Sina also manufactured significant contributions to philosophy. He wrote extensively on metaphysics, ethics, and epistemology, and his philosophical Thoughts had a profound effect on Islamic thought and Western philosophy. His notion of "vital existence" influenced afterwards Islamic philosophers including Al-Ghazali and Averroes, and his Thoughts on the nature on the soul and the connection between brain and system foreshadowed later developments in Western philosophy. Ibn Sina's dual skills in drugs and philosophy made him a towering figure in the two fields, and his affect proceeds being felt in the trendy world.
